A Day in the Life:
- Lead and motivate a team of employees, including training, scheduling, and coaching to ensure a positive and efficient work environment.
- Ensure that all customers have a memorable dining experience by providing excellent service and resolving any issues promptly.
- Oversee day-to-day restaurant operations, including inventory management, cash handling, and ensuring compliance with all company policies and procedures.
- Maintain high-quality food preparation and presentation standards to meet Taco Bell's brand expectations.
- Enforce safety and cleanliness standards, ensuring a safe and hygienic environment for both customers and employees.
- Assist with managing labor and food costs to maximize profitability.
- Address and resolve any issues or challenges that may arise during your shift.
Requirements:
- Minimum 1 year of experience as an Assistant General Manager in food service or retail environment, including Profit & Loss responsibility preferably in quick serve restaurant (QSR).
- Managers must be at least 18 years old.
- Availability to close the restaurant at least two nights a week.
- Ability to lift, carry, stack, push or pull heavy objects.
- Stand and walk constantly for entire shifts.
- Maneuver through compact spaces safely and operate restaurant equipment.
